The Role
The Director, Facilities provides leadership, oversight, and strategic direction for Facility Engineering, Safety, and Security functions across Providence Health & Services ministries in the Oregon Region, including Providence Hood River, Medford, Milwaukie, Newberg, Portland, Seaside, St. Vincent, and Willamette Falls hospitals.
This role ensures that Oregon Region Facility Engineering and Safety departments implement PH&S standardized processes, deliver high ‑ quality services in a consistent and uniform manner, and operate in full compliance with all applicable regulatory, accreditation, and safety standards. The Director balances system, regional, and local initiatives while addressing the unique needs of individual ministries and communities.
Key challenges include reducing operational expenses while improving service and compliance, managing energy and utility costs, maintaining a diverse workforce, and navigating a complex, matrixed management environment in a rapidly evolving healthcare landscape.
What You’ll Do
Regional Leadership & Oversight
Provide leadership, strategic direction, and operational oversight for Oregon Region Plant Operations and Maintenance, Facility Services, Grounds Maintenance, and Safety functions. Inform and educate facility and safety leaders on system‑wide vision, standards, and performance goals. Build and sustain trusted relationships with facility managers, safety leaders, and senior executives through effective communication and timely issue resolution. Support the free exchange of ideas, information, and best practices across ministries. Regulatory Compliance, Safety & Emergency Management
Maintain current knowledge of regulatory requirements and accreditation standards, ensuring compliance with Joint Commission and CMS Conditions of Participation. Assess Life Safety Code compliance and manage remediation of deficiencies. Serve as the Oregon Region Fire Marshal, enforcing fire and life safety codes and ensuring reliability of fire and life safety systems across hospital campuses. Intervene when environmental conditions pose immediate threats to life, health, equipment, or facilities. Direct emergency response planning for facility engineering and safety departments and respond in person to emergency incidents when required. Operational Excellence & Continuous Improvement
Lead facility and safety operational improvement initiatives, incorporating emerging facility and information‑management technologies. Evaluate organizational structures and workflows and implement improvements to enhance quality, service, and cost efficiency. Share innovative practices and process improvements with the PH&S Facility Engineering Council. Ensure purchasing strategies and service contracts align with system sourcing standards and goals. Financial & Capital Stewardship
Direct development and oversight of operational expense and capital budgets for Oregon Region facilities and safety programs. Lead long‑term capital planning and facility re‑investment programs. Direct group purchasing processes for service contracts in alignment with PH&S standards. Lead the Oregon Region Energy Management Program in collaboration with the System Office to manage utility and energy costs. People, Labor & Stakeholder Leadership
Manage and support Oregon Region facility managers and Building Systems Engineers, including hiring, performance management, coaching, discipline, training, and advancement. Oversee standardized training and education programs to maintain facility engineering staff competency. Direct negotiations and support administration of union agreements with Operating Engineers where applicable. Participate actively in Oregon Region committees and councils. Partner with community organizations and trade associations to support workforce diversity reflective of local communities. Develop and deliver presentations on regulatory compliance, system initiatives, performance metrics, and regional projects to a variety of audiences. Safety & Environmental Health
Support Oregon Region Safety Managers through resource development, training, and professional advancement. Support uniform Safety, Hazardous Materials, and Waste Management programs in compliance with federal and state regulations. Collaborate with PH&S Employee Health Services to reduce employee injuries and support safe return‑to‑work practices.

Organization
Providence has been serving the Pacific Northwest since 1856 when Mother Joseph of the Sacred Heart and four other Sisters of Providence arrived in Vancouver, Washington Territory. As the largest healthcare system and largest private employer in Oregon, Providence is located in areas ranging from the Columbia Gorge to the wine country to sunny southern Oregon to charming coastal communities to the urban setting of Portland.
Our award-winning and comprehensive medical centers are known for outstanding programs in cancer, cardiology, neurosciences, orthopedics, women's services, emergency and trauma care, pediatrics and neonatal intensive care. Our not-for-profit network also provides a full spectrum of care with leading-edge diagnostics and treatment, outpatient health centers, physician groups and clinics, numerous outreach programs, and hospice and home care.
